Application: ELISA:
In a sandwich ELISA (assuming 100 μL/well) , a concentration of 4.0-8.0 μg/mL of this antibody will detect at least 100 pg/mL of recombinant human TGFβ1 when used in conjunction with compatible secondary reagents.
Western Blot:
To detect hTGFβ1 by Western Blot analysis this antibody can be used at a concentration of 2.0-4.0 μg/mL. Used in conjunction with compatible secondary reagents the detection limit for recombinant hTGFβ1 is 2.0-4.0 ng/lane, under non-reducing conditions. In a dot blot, a 1:500 dilution of this antibody exhibited complete cross reactivity with human TGFβ2 and TGFβ3 isotypes. Reduced cross reactivity was shown at a 1:1000 dilution.
